Gateway Foundation — Illinois

Substance Abuse · Illinois

Gateway Foundation operates 12 Illinois treatment locations including Aurora, Chicago Independence, Pekin, Caseyville, Carbondale, and Springfield. The Women's Residential program at the Carbondale and Springfield campuses offers gender-specific care and partners with TANF and child welfare.
